python中excel按列中数值合并

两个表两列数据如下
1 张三 3 王五
2 李四 4 赵六
3 王五 5 刘七
4 赵六 6 吴八
如何用python整合成
新列
1 张三
2 李四
3 王五
4 赵六
5 刘七 新增
6 吴八 新增


import pandas as pd

table1 = {'id':['1', '2', '3', '4'],'name':['张三', '李四', '王五', '赵六']}
table2 = {'id':['3', '4', '5', '6'],'name':['王五', '赵六', '刘七', '吴八']}


df1 = pd.DataFrame(table1)
df2 = pd.DataFrame(table2)
print(df1)
print('------------')
print(df2)
print('------------')
result = pd.merge(df1,df2,how='outer')
print(result)

【以下回答由 GPT 生成】

我很高兴为您解答问题!然而,问题描述中未提到具体问题,请提供更详细的问题描述,以便我能够帮助您解决问题。



【相关推荐】



如果你已经解决了该问题, 非常希望你能够分享一下解决方案, 写成博客, 将相关链接放在评论区, 以帮助更多的人 ^-^